About This Podcast

The Advanced Artificial Intelligence Audio Course is a focused, audio-first series that takes you deep into the technical foundations and emerging challenges of modern AI systems. Designed for professionals, students, and certification candidates, this course explains advanced AI concepts through clear, structured narration—no slides, no filler, just direct, practical learning. Each episode unpacks core topics such as neural architectures, model embeddings, optimization, interpretability, and evaluation, showing how these elements come together to create powerful and reliable AI systems. Whether you’re working in development, research, or applied security, the course helps you understand how modern models are designed, trained, and deployed in real-world environments. Beyond architecture and algorithms, this Audio Course also explores the resilience and trustworthiness of AI—examining attack surfaces, data poisoning, model inversion, and the security controls needed to protect AI systems throughout their lifecycle. It provides insight into ethical risks, bias mitigation, governance frameworks, and assurance practices that keep advanced models safe and compliant. You’ll learn how leading organizations balance innovation with reliability, and how these same principles can guide your own technical and professional growth. Developed by BareMetalCyber.com, the Advanced Artificial Intelligence Audio Course delivers in-depth, exam-aligned instruction that bridges theory with practical application. Each episode builds technical fluency while reinforcing best practices in AI design, operations, and governance—helping you think critically, work securely, and lead confidently in the evolving world of intelligent systems.
